About PrintSmith Vision

ePS PrintSmith Vision is a print estimating software designed to help businesses in the government, printing, publishing, textiles and other sectors produce estimates and track production processes. The platform enables administrators to manage job costing, accounts payable/receivable, payment processing, invoicing and other financial operations.

Managers can automatically update progress status across job tags in real-time using the drag-and-drop interface. ePS PrintSmith Vision enables teams to record location of jobs across production and collect shop floor data in real-time. Additionally, employees can manage sales orders, process credit card transactions and print receipts on a centralized dashboard.

ePS PrintSmith Vision lets businesses integrate the system with several third-party applications including ePS MarketDirect StoreFront. Pricing is available on request and support is extended via phone, email, forum, knowledge base and an online contact form.

    Decent POS Software for Print Shops

    4

    Over all I use this program 4-5 hours a day and it has made our shop more profitable and able to work with a smaller staff. I am the main user in our shop and while the learning curve from a very old 2006 desktop version to PSV was steep I mostly like the program and can quickly get done what I need. The old program I had to open multiple windows and drag & drop for bringing forward older jobs (more than one) into new jobs. Now we can import old jobs from any account using the add job window. I do wish there was more flexibility on packing lists for when we have split jobs. as it is I save as a PDF and edit the PDF to show what is actually delivering.

    Pros:
    Having used PS for about 13 years I can say it has improved greatly over the years. I find it very functional and intuitive. I can take deposits, track orders and see our profitability. It is easy to do job builds and save presets. Looking up older orders and pulling them forward is very easy as well. I can take a job build and easily transfer to a different account for similar jobs. We have connected our PSV to SalesForce for sending out invoices, statements and following up on estimates. This has simply added to the functionality. We also have ShipExpress which allows us to ship right from an invoice and pull all the pricing into PSV as well as tracking numbers.
    Cons:
    I am no a big fan of some updates made in version 7.0.0.6166. Most especially the number search bar at the top. This used to hold the number so if you typed in a number for an invoice but it was on the estimate selection you could just change the selection to invoice and hit search. Now if you click anywhere on the screen the number disappears and you have to retype it. Sounds like a small thing - and had it not worked beautifully before that maybe it wouldn't be so aggravating. Also when processing a credit card we would leave the invoice # in that bar so once processed we could click search and go right to the invoice to both verify and print a receipt (PSV won't connect to my printer for some reason for receipts). This version also has slowed down load time. We have 30 years of customer info in this program, since this upgrade it lags when loading account searches. Very annoying. Also issues connecting to Ship Express and losing printer specifications. Sometimes my notes disappear while saving. very annoying and time consuming when this happens. Sometimes it also happens when converting from an estimate to a job - but only on clients that have notes saved to pop into all tickets.

    Pros:
    It's a great platform overall. It's pretty intuitive to use once you get the hang of it. It has a lot of data available in the database if you get into creating your own reports, which is very useful. I had positive interactions with support as well.
    Cons:
    The reporting module is not great. You have to really know how to code in inet designer and all the reports are static. We had to purchase another product (Plan Prophet) on top of PrintSmith to give us all that we need. PS has a very archaic system for tracking customer followups and team collaboration and there is no way to automate any customer followups or pretty much anything. I really dislike the super long term contracts whenever you ask for a new user license. Support hours are ridiculously expensive. You have to pay a lot of money for training. PS does not have any good video training. You have to heavily rely on the user manual, which is a great manual if you are a super technical person. Videos would be a lot more helpful. It also takes a long time to get new features implemented.

    Pros:
    We have used Printsmith since 1997. Although there have been many updates and changes to the program, I have always found it invaluable in running our business. The ease at which you can create an estimate (utilizing comparable past jobs and estimates from any client account), seamless conversion to Job Ticket, Invoice and ultimately post to billing saves hours of work each week. Printsmith stores all of our Client Account History, allowing us to predict what our client base is likely to be ordering in any given month, and allowing us to them in advance to confirm upcoming orders. The built in accounting in Printsmith allows us to easily track profit and jobs won or lost, allowing us to print out comprehensive weekly and monthly close-outs that make the work for our Accounting Firm go off without a hitch.

    Pros:
    All the estimates and invoices located in one place makes PrintSmith very practical. Along with a Till function this is a very capable piece of software. The imposition tool allows any member of our staff to see how many items should be printed on any lay to achieve the required productivity.
    Cons:
    When quoting large format work it would be great if the system could handle different sizes and orientations on a single printed board. As the system cannot handle this we have to guess at our production which is not always correct.
